Here are a few important points about the SBS series. Originally premiering September 24th, 2005, "Lovers in Prague" stars Jeon Do-yeon, Kim Joo-hyuk, Kim Min-jun, Yoon Se-a. The show spans 1 season(s) and currently holds a 65/100 rating on TMDb, which is based on reviews from 2 verified users.

Looking for a quick plot summary? Here’s the plot: "Jae Hee, a diplomat in Prague, who is getting over a break-up, meets police detective Sang Hyun and romance blossoms. Jae Hee is the daughter of the Korean President and has to maintain a low profile. Jae Hee's ex, Young Woo and Sang Hyun's ex, Hye Joo make things complicated with secrets surrounding them. With the differences in social status, Jae Hee and Sang Hyun have to fight to see if the love that started in Prague can be overcome from what is trying to keep them apart."
